Output afaae5e392dd749fce7fad37273fb836fbbbbeead4458e1b8fffc7a017c1e13e:20

value
19269286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5595514413e0134a574688c3a0806649e7b241f5 OP_EQUAL
address
MFhgYVbBXR2GyNUnekEWrPyFNyVB4tZgPQ
transaction
afaae5e392dd749fce7fad37273fb836fbbbbeead4458e1b8fffc7a017c1e13e
spent
true